It DOES damage your hair, if you go all blonde you can not use color because color does not lift color, so your only option is bleach. If you bleach your whole head it will not come out even at all, do a heavy chunky highlight leave it on for as long as possible without if breaking off. Then if its too light tone it with a semi-permanent

The only way to go blonde from dark is to bleach or strip the colour out of your hair completely. If you have been colouring your hair for years and it's been dark everytime, you have layers and layers of colour on the hair. I am a hair stylist and the only way I truly recomend going light, strip it gradually (sally's makes a great stripper), do regular conditioning treatments (thick moisturizing conditioner mask with heat applied), then begin to bleach GRADUALLY. If you do too much to your hair at once, expect it to become brittle and break. This is what we call dried, dyed, and petrified. Hope this helps!
